Transaction e48dcd9616117291494a4a680611f7b665abc13ee98ee711190563cf5adadfe0
1 Input
2 Outputs
- e48dcd9616117291494a4a680611f7b665abc13ee98ee711190563cf5adadfe0:0
- e48dcd9616117291494a4a680611f7b665abc13ee98ee711190563cf5adadfe0:1
value 25906475
address 3DKH8cwhqTGESAuCGK3b7gmiFXnx3Vr5xC
value 380836726
address 18AxpwNm3UZs2mg8CqEVdj2Y6DfbhjAZSR